GW Volleyball to Hold Adult Clinics in September
8/24/2011 12:00:00 AM | Women's Volleyball
Aug. 24, 2011
WASHINGTON- The George Washington volleyball coaching staff and student-athletes will hold a clinic for adults of all skill levels every Tuesday in September. The clinic will be held at the Charles E. Smith Center.
The clinic will include over 10 hours of instruction, including both fundamentals and advanced concepts, by head coach Amanda Ault, assistant coaches Ryan Freeburg, Erin Moore and the 2011 Colonials. Participants will also receive an Adult Clinic T-shirt.
